Trading Desk in the Southeast

It's about time to start looking for a job after graduation and I want to get into trading, preferably for a decent sized bank but I don't think i want to live in NYC. I was wondering if someone could shed some light as to some banks that have desks in the Southeast. I know Robinson Humphrey(SunTrust) in Atlanta, I think BoA has a desk in Charlotte, and Raymond James has something in St. Pete. I didn't know if any BBs had branch/satellite desks located in places other than their headquarters in NYC. Are there any other banks around the southeast that have trading desks that might make a good place to start a career? And I've heard the ceiling as far as pay is a little higher in NYC, but other than that are there any other major differences in going to work for say SunTrust versus a BB in NYC?
